The global cell voltage monitoring system market is poised for a surge, with a projected CAGR of 7.2% between 2024 and 2030. This growth is fueled by the rising demand for electric vehicles, renewable energy storage, and industrial batteries. These applications rely on multiple interconnected cells, making voltage monitoring crucial for performance, safety, and lifespan.

The market offers diverse solutions, from standalone devices to integrated systems. Advancements in wireless communication and cloud-based data analysis are further propelling market expansion. These features enable remote monitoring and real-time insights, optimizing battery health and maintenance.

Market Growth Drivers:

  • Increasing demand for electric vehicles: Electric vehicles (EVs) are becoming increasingly popular due to their environmental benefits and lower operating costs. However, EVs rely on large battery packs, which need to be carefully monitored to ensure optimal performance and safety. Cell voltage monitoring systems play a vital role in ensuring the health of these battery packs.
  • Growth of renewable energy storage systems: Renewable energy sources, such as solar and wind power, are becoming increasingly important in the global energy mix. However, these sources are intermittent, and their output needs to be stored for use when the sun is not shining or the wind is not blowing. Battery storage systems are essential for this purpose, and cell voltage monitoring systems are crucial for ensuring the safe and efficient operation of these systems.
  • Rising demand for industrial batteries: Industrial batteries are used in a wide range of applications, such as data centers, power plants, and manufacturing facilities. As these industries grow, the demand for industrial batteries is also expected to increase. Cell voltage monitoring systems are essential for ensuring the reliability and lifespan of these batteries.
